NHL: 

The Tampa Bay Lightning have given head coach Jon Cooper of Prince George a three-year contract extension through the 2024-25 season.

The two-time defending Stanley Cup champion Lightning will begin the NHL regular season tonight (Tuesday) when they host the Pittsburgh Penguins (4:30 PT).

The only other league game this evening has Seattle at Vegas (7:00).

WHL (PG Cougars)

The Prince George Cougars have started their season 0-3 after losing on the road 6-4 to the Vancouver Giants Friday and 8-3 to Kamloops Blazers Saturday.

The Cougars have scored 11 goals while surrendering a Western Conference high 19.

Prince George will play its next six games against Victoria.

The Cougars host the (1-2) Royals Saturday night at 7:00 and Sunday afternoon at 2:00.

BCHL
(PG Spruce Kings)

The Prince George Spruce Kings split their first two games on the road.

The Spruce Kings crushed Merritt 8-1 Friday before losing 5-3 to West Kelowna on Saturday.

The (1-1) Spruce Kings entertain the (0-2) Merritt Centennials on Friday and Saturday in their first home games of the season.

NFL: (Final game in Week 5)

Baltimore  31  Indianapolis  25  (OT)

The Ravens erased a 25-9 fourth-quarter deficit to improve to 4-1. The Colts dropped to 1-4.

After five weeks, Arizona is the only unbeaten team at 5-0 while Jacksonville and Detroit are the only winless teams at 0-5.

#

Jon Gruden has resigned as head coach of the Las Vegas Raiders.

His decision came after offensive emails he sent before being hired in 2018 were revealed.

Canada West Soccer: (UNBC Timberwolves)

The UNBC Timberwolves have just four games left (men and women) in Canada West Soccer.

The UNBC soccer teams visit Fraser Valley on Friday and Sunday before hosting Thompson Rivers on October 23rd and 24th (at Masich Place starting at noon for the women and 2:15 for the men).

The UNBC men have one win, four losses, and three ties after eight games while the UNBC women have one win, six losses, and one tie.
